How it works

This is how it works with me

  1. Connect: Reach out for a free 20-minute consultation. We’ll talk about what you’re looking for, answer questions, and decide together if we’re a good fit. If it feels right, we’ll schedule your first session.

  2. Begin the work: In our sessions, we’ll move at a comfortable pace. You’ll gain tools, insight, and support as we use evidence based approaches (including EMDR if appropriate) to process what’s been weighing on you.

  3. Move Towards your goals: As we work through what’s been holding you back, the aim is feel more grounded and at ease in your life.
